What to Eat
Cromer is famous for its crabs, so be sure to try them if you visit the town. Other local specialties include Cromer mussels, Cromer lobsters, and Cromer oysters.
Where to Go
There are a number of things to see and do in Cromer, including:
- Cromer Pier: This Victorian pier is one of the most popular attractions in Cromer. It offers stunning views of the coastline and is home to a number of shops, restaurants, and cafes.
- Cromer Beach: This sandy beach is perfect for swimming, sunbathing, and building sandcastles.
- Cromer Lighthouse: This lighthouse is located on the east side of Cromer and offers panoramic views of the town and the coastline.
- The Royal Cromer Golf Club: This golf club is one of the oldest and most prestigious in the United Kingdom.
- Cromer Museum: This museum tells the story of Cromer and its people.
